אלגוריתם דו-כיווניות של יוניקוד

אלגוריתם דו-כיווניות מחליט אם הטקסט זורם מימין לשמאל או להפך. אלגוריתם = כלל בתוכנה שמקבל החלטות. תווים בעברית וערבית זורמים מימין לשמאל. תווים באנגלית זורמים שמאל־לימין. מספרים בדרך כלל שמאל־לימין. סימני פיסוק כמו נקודה הם נייטרליים. = תווים נייטרליים =
תווים נייטרליים הם תווים בלי כיוון, כמו נקודה. הם מקבלים את הכיוון מהתווים סביבם. אם הם בין כיוונים שונים, הם לוקחים את הכיוון של התו שאחריהם.
לפעמים הסדר של מילים או מספרים יוצא לא נכון. לדוגמה, קידומת במספר טלפון עשויה להיבחר במקום הלא נכון. אפשר לתקן זאת בעזרת תווים חבויים שמכריחים כיוון, אבל זה קשה להקלדה רגילה.
יש שני תווים סמויים: LRM ו‑RLM. הם לא נראים, אבל הם אומרים לטקסט להזין כיוון שמאל־לימין או ימין־לשמאל. הם לא זמינים בכל מקלדת עברית. בגרסאות מסוימות של מערכות הפעלה יש דרכים להכניסם.

תגובות גולשים

התגובה תפורסם באתר לאחר אישור המערכת

עדיין אין תגובות. היה הראשון להגיב!